Typical Home Appliance Problems and Their Symptoms
When your home appliances start breaking down, it's important to recognize the signs early. Overlooking them can bring about bigger problems and expensive fixings. As an example, if your refrigerator isn't cooling correctly, you may notice cozy spots or condensation creating. This might indicate a falling short compressor or an obstructed vent.Your dish washer might reveal issues with unclean dishes or unusual noises throughout cycles. If you hear grinding or clanking, it's time to investigate.A cleaning device that won't rotate or drain can leave you with soaked laundry, recommending a clogged up drainpipe or a malfunctioning pump.Lastly, if your oven's temperature level appears off or it takes permanently to preheat, you may be handling a defective thermostat. By staying sharp to these symptoms, you can resolve concerns before they intensify right into significant repair work.

Electrical Screening Tools
Alongside standard hand tools, electric testing tools play a crucial role in home appliance repair. These devices assist you diagnose electrical concerns and guarantee devices work safely. A multimeter is crucial; it gauges voltage, current, and resistance, enabling you to pinpoint issues promptly. A non-contact voltage tester is another must-have, allowing you detect online cords without making straight get in touch with, boosting your safety and security. Clamp meters are excellent for measuring existing circulation in cords without disconnecting them, conserving you time and initiative. Furthermore, circuit testers can quickly check if electrical outlets are working correctly. By utilizing these gadgets, you'll streamline your troubleshooting process and improve your repair service abilities, making device upkeep a whole lot simpler.

Repairing Washing Appliances: Tips and Techniques
When your washing appliances begin acting up, it can really feel overwhelming, yet troubleshooting them doesn't have to be a headache. Start by inspecting the power supply. Verify the home appliance is connected in and the electrical outlet is working. Next, check the door or cover switch; a malfunctioning switch can protect against the machine from operating.For washers, if it's not rotating, look for out of balance loads. Redistributing the clothes might resolve the issue. If your dryer isn't heating, tidy the lint filter and check the vent for blockages.Listen for uncommon noises; they can indicate a problem. If your home appliance is leaking, check the hoses for cracks or loosened links. Paper any type of error codes presented on electronic displays, as they can assist you in determining the issue. Finally, get in touch with the customer handbook for particular fixing ideas related to your version.
Security Precautions to Take Throughout Services
Before you start any appliance fixings, it's essential to focus on security to avoid mishaps or injuries. Disconnect the appliance or transform off the circuit breaker here to guarantee no power reaches it while you work. Usage protected tools to reduce the threat of electric shock. When to Call an Expert for Help
Exactly how do you recognize if it's time to contact an expert for appliance repair work? If you have actually attempted basic troubleshooting without success, it's a clear indication. As an example, if your home appliance still won't start or reveals uncommon noises after resetting it, don't think twice to look for specialist help.When you observe leakages, smoke, or burning smells, prioritize safety and call a pro immediately. These problems can result in more considerable damage or pose risks to your home.Also, if your device is under guarantee, speaking to an expert is commonly the ideal path.
